    The Logistics Coordinator should assume general responsibility for an overview of all shipments from point of transit to the US, up until the clients’ door. This includes customs releases, warehousing, and any Stateside transit. The Logistics Coordinator will work alongside the Logistics, Warehouse team and closely with the Warehouse Manager and QA to manage the receipt of shipments, as well as with the Sales Reps to ensure clients’ needs are met and consignments are delivered according to their requirements. They should have excellent communication skills and be a team player.

     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Entering Sales Orders into the system.
    • Material releases - submit docs to FDA, work with shipping agents/FedEx as required.
    • Instruction of shipping agents on delivery of materials from the port.
    • Warehouse functions –
      • Ensure the arrival of materials at the warehouse.
      • Check drums/paperwork/labeling.
      • Warehouse transfers where necessary
      • Instruct on shipments to other warehouses/clients via relevant documentation in the ERP system.
    • Handling of Customer Returns – including liaising with the client for physical return, logging the return in ERP, and liaising with Supplier Side Team for vendor returns where necessary, and with reference to Quality Dept as required.
    •  Log process for all customer shipments from any dispatches from warehouses in the US other than LGM, where shipment log is not generated by any other team member.
    •  Keeping clients and sales reps updated of delivery schedules on pending orders.
